Tourism Awards
Moreton Bay and Islands Tourism Awards (MB&ITA)

The 2012 Moreton Bay & Islands Tourism Awards were announced at a gala dinner held at The Landing at Dockside on Thursday 19th July.
Winners were announced in 18 categories:

The Judges Gold Award, sponsored by Coroneo Advertising, is presented to the highest scoring award nomination and was won by Abbey Medieval Festival. Judges Special Commendation Award went to Uluramaya Retreat Cabins at Wamuran.
As this is the third year of these regional awards, Hall of Fame trophies were awarded to winners who have won their category for 3 consecutive years, including:
- Abbey Medieval Festival
- Redlands Indigiscapes Centre
- Moreton Bay Region Visitor Information Centre
- Big Red Cat - Sea Stradbroke
- Straddie Kingfisher Tours
- Sails Restaurant & Function Centre

The Moreton Bay and Islands Tourism Awards (MB&ITA) recognise the important role that the local tourism industry plays in product and destination awareness and as a significant economic contributor to the region.
The Moreton Bay Task Force of Mayors comprising Brisbane City Council, Moreton Bay Regional Council and Redland City Council endorses the awards and is committed to ongoing support. The Task Force members have worked together over a number of years to support the local tourism industry, events and business sectors to gain recognition and acknowledgement of their achievements and and raise awareness of Brisbane’s Moreton Bay and Islands as a quality destination.
The program is primarily to showcase the local tourism industry, celebrate sustainable business procedures, excellence in customer service and innovation and the implementation of environmental and risk practices.
